Project::OSiRiON - Git repositories
Project::OSiRiON
News . About . Screenshots . Downloads . Forum . Wiki . Tracker . Git
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
Diffstat (limited to 'src/render/dust.cc')
-rw-r--r--src/render/dust.cc5
1 files changed, 2 insertions, 3 deletions
diff --git a/src/render/dust.cc b/src/render/dust.cc
index cb8d84d..fe74536 100644
--- a/src/render/dust.cc
+++ b/src/render/dust.cc
@@ -106,12 +106,11 @@ void Dust::draw(math::Color const &dustcolor)
}
- traillength = math::max(math::max(core::localcontrol()->movement(), core::localcontrol()->speed() * 0.5f), 0.5f);
+ traillength = math::max(core::localcontrol()->speed() * 0.5f, 0.5f);
traillength = traillength * TRAILLENGHT / LOWSPEEDLIMIT;
math::Color color(dustcolor);
- alpha = math::max(core::localcontrol()->movement(), core::localcontrol()->speed() * 0.5f);
- math::clamp(alpha, 0.0f, 1.0f);
+ alpha = math::min(core::localcontrol()->speed(), 1.0f);
color.a = 0.25f * alpha;
gl::begin(gl::Lines);